Zusammenfassung: | The present invention relates in to a device for supplying mechanical power to start at least one engine, with a power supply device for supplying electrical power with an alternating voltage and constant frequency; and with a number, N1, of conversion devices for the conversion of the supplied electrical power to a respective mechanical power for a respective engine, wherein a respective conversion device has a cascade starter generator for direct conversion of the supplied electrical power to mechanical power, wherein the cascade starter generator has a first stator, a second stator, a first rotor and a second rotor, the first stator being integrally formed with the second stator and the first rotor being integrally formed with the second rotor. The present invention further relates to an aircraft comprising such a power distribution network and a method for supplying mechanical power to start at least one engine in an aircraft. |
